121. MHG Signs Anantara Resort in Zanzibar
Thailand-based Minor Hotels Group has signed an Anantara resort in Zanzibar. Scheduled to open in 2020 as part of the Zanzibar Amber Resort mixed-use lifestyle community, the Anantara Zanzibar Resort will occupy in excess of 1,000 hectares of prime Indian Ocean coastline in the north east of Zanzibar.

127. Russia Beat Hong Kong to Win Ustinov Cup
Russia beat Hong Kong 39-27 in the second game of the two-test series at Hong Kong Football Club on Saturday. Russia won the inaugural Ustinov Cup with a clean sweep having won the first test last week, 31-10. The game on Saturday was much closer however, as Hong Kongs dangerous backline proved they can operate with the barest of possession, but still pose a threat.
